A Step-by-Step Guide to Our Water Extraction Process

The process of water extraction is more than just a series of steps – it’s a carefully crafted plan to reduce damage and get your condo back to normal as soon as possible.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ure that every step is executed with precision and care. We understand that time is of the essence, especially in the first 24 to 48 hours after a water incident. Our goal is to get you back to dry quickly and safely.

Step 1: Assessment and Initial Response

Our team will arrive at your condo within the hour and begin assessing the situation. We’ll identify the source of the leak, the extent of the damage, and the best course of action to take.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and ensuring a safe environment for you and your loved ones.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Once the assessment is complete, our team will begin the process of water extraction using our state-of-the-art equipment. We’ll remove the standing water, and then use specialized drying equipment to speed up the evaporation process.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and further damage to your property.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the initial extraction and drying, we’ll continue to monitor the area to ensure that it’s completely dry. We’ll use specialized equipment to dehumidify the air and prevent moisture from seeping back into the affected areas.

Step 4: Monitoring and Cleaning

Our team will continue to monitor the area for several days to ensure that it’s completely dry and free from any potential hazards. We’ll also perform a thorough cleaning of the area to remove any remaining moisture and debris.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ion

Once the area is completely dry and clean,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that everything is in order. We’ll then provide you with a detailed report of the work we’ve done and offer any necessary recommendations for future maintenance.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Downey, CA

The cost of condo water extraction in Downey,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the size of the affected area.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present.
Monitoring and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of debris present.
Equipment Rental $200 – $1,000 The type and duration of equipment rental.
